Comrades Club Competitions Finals Night

The Annual Club Competitions Finals were played tonight (Friday) & here's a quick roundup of the Winners & Runners Up.

The Veterans Final was contested between Dave Greathead & Hugh Baker. Hugh was still suffering with a niggling cold & couldn't make the most of his handicap & Dave retained his title by 2 frames to 0.

The Doubles Final was between Dave Rowe & Nigel Woods and Rob House & Simon Ellam. Dave & Nigel started off +15 handicap (per frame) over Rob & Simon & it was an uphill battle for them over the aggregate score of the 2 frames. Dave & Nigel potted some good balls & played good tactics. Rob & Simon were not having the best of running despite potting some quality single reds but had to rely on good safety to prise an opening. With 4 reds left at the end of the 2nd frame Simon & Rob required snookers. It was to be a insurmountable task & the 'new boys' triumphed to take their 1st Doubles Title.

Rob had a second bite at a title in the Billiards against reigning Champion Pete Billingham. It was always going to be a long game with the final being first to 250 points & Rob was quick out of the blocks racing to a 60+ lead before Pete started to score. Rob was scoring regularly at each visit & Pete had to dig deep to just to pull level. Rob made a nice 28 break to which Pete responded with a 29 & at the halfway stage Robs lead had being closed to 20. It was nip & tuck through to the winning line with Pete briefly taking the lead before Rob reached the 250 target first, taking the title for his second time.

The 'Blue Ribband' Singles event was between Dave Rowe & Pete Billingham, with Dave having a 25 handicap. In the first frame Pete made a 24 early on to pull back the handicap & kept the frame tight, leading up to the colours. After potting the green Pete 'jawed' the brown & it was to be the decisive miss that Dave pounced on, taking brown, blue, a fantastic long pink with perfect position on the black to take the first frame. In the second frame Dave potted some incredible long reds & kept the lead throughout to take his 1st Singles Title (& a double winner with the Doubles Title).
